乐趣区

rabbitmq

一、rabbitmq 关键字

Binding:Exchange 和 Exchange、Queue 之间的连接关系
Queue:实际存储消息。
Durability:是否持久化,Durable:是,Transient:否。
Auto delete:如选 yes,代表当最后一个监听被移除之后,该 Queue 会自动删除。
Message:服务器和应用程序之间传送的数据。本质上就是一段数据,由 Properties 和 Payload(Body) 组成。常用属性:delivery mode、headers(自定义属性)
Virtual host:虚拟主机,用于进行逻辑隔离,最上层的消息路由。一个 Virtual Host 里面可以有若干个 Exchange 和 Queue,同一个 Virtual Host 里面不能有相同名称的 Exchange 或者 Queue。

一、rabbitmq 高级特性

  1. 消息如何保证 100% 的投递成功?
  2. 幂等性概念详解
  3. 在海量订单产生的业务高峰期,如何避免消息的重复消费问题?
  4. Confirm 确认消息、Return 返回消息
退出移动版